The Safety Net: How FDIC Insurance Works
One of the biggest reasons why people flock to CDs is the safety net provided by FDIC insurance. Each depositor is insured up to $250,000 per bank, which means your money is protected even if the bank fails. This security makes investing in CDs not just attractive but incredibly safe compared to volatile stocks or risky ventures during uncertain economic times.
Terms You Need to Know Before Investing
Before you jump into opening a CD account, it’s crucial to understand some key terms such as ‘term length’, ‘early withdrawal penalties’, and ‘APY’. Most high-rate CDs require you to lock in your funds for a specific period (ranging from six months to several years). Be wary of early withdrawal penalties; breaking the term could cost you dearly and negate those enticing interest gains. So read the fine print carefully before signing up.
